[This review was collected as part of a promotion.] Nice piece of equipment, Took a few cuts to get use to waiting for the chain/motor to come up to speed before cutting branch (etc). Very nice not having to have to add/or mix gas and oil. The bar/chain oiler took a few minutes of running unloaded before being primed through the whole system. At first I didn't think the oiling was going to work. Instructions should be updated to indicate it may take running for 2-3 minutes before the bar and chain is fully oiled. The only other suggestion is concerning the chain tightening / replacing instructions to be clearer on not fully tightening the cover (bar) nuts until the chain tension is properly adjusted.

Having killed another 2-stroke chainsaw, i decided to try the Toro 60V chainsaw a try. Already having a 60V battery from another purchase made this purchase decision easier. I live on a couple acres and am clearing pine scrub. Its not heavy work, but the few trees and all the medium brush I have done so far, the saw has had no trouble tackling. For the light work I do, over the course of 5 or 6 hours a day, the battery has maintained its charge. The chain seems to lag on its spin up to full speed whereas my 2-strokes seemed much more responsive. This is really not an issue, it just seems to not spin up as fast. All-in-all, I am thoroughly pleased with the saw and even happier not to mess with gas and oil or having to rebuild a carb again.
